Frequently Asked Questions

How far in advance can I make these?
You can make these 1-2 days in advance and store them in an airtight container.

How can I make these thicker?

If you want super thick rice krispies treats, you can double the recipe or use an 8×8 pan, except for the cup of cereal on the top. That amount will remain the same, unless you want less.

Things to Note:

  • You may not have to leave them for an hour, as they often set pretty quickly. However, I tend to let them have plenty of time to rest as they’re easier to cut and less messy that way.
  • You don’t have to add the mini marshmallows into the mixture. You can replace it with more cereal. It calls for 2 cups mini marshmallows so swap it for 2 cups cereal.
  • Don’t press the mixture down into the pan too hard or you’ll make the treats tough. They’ll pack really tight making them like jerky tough. Believe me…I made this mistake before. Don’t do it!
  • You can make the butter and marshmallow mixture over the stove instead of the microwave, if desired. It’s just quicker to use the microwave, which is why it’s my cooking method of choice.

How to Make Lucky Charms Rice Krispies Treats

Slice your butter into chunks and combine it with 8 cups of mini marshmallows in a large mixing bowl. Microwave for 2 minutes.

mini marshmallows and butter in bowl

Immediately stir until the marshmallows are no longer chunky and the butter is fully mixed in.

Add the remaining 2 cups marshmallows and 5 cups Lucky Charms to the melted marshmallows and gently fold together until the cereal and unmelted marshmallows are fully covered.

Spray a 9×13 cake pan with nonstick cooking spray. Add the mixture to the pan and gently spread even in the pan.

lucky charms rice krispies spread into pan

Sprinkle the remaining cup of Lucky Charms over the top and lightly press to ensure it sticks to the top.

lucky charms rice krispies treats in pan

Let rest for about an hour or until set.

Slice into squares and enjoy!

Lucky Charms Rice Krispies Treats

No ratings yet
Brittanie
Indulge in a touch of nostalgia with Lucky Charms Rice Krispies Treats. These gooey, marshmallow-y treats are made with everyone's favorite cereal, Lucky Charms, and the classic crunch of Rice Krispies.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 2 minutes
Total Time 2 minutes
Servings 1

Ingredients
  

  • 10 Cups Mini Marshmallows
  • 6 Cups Lucky Charms
  • 6 Tablespoons Butter
  • Nonstick Cooking Spray

Instructions
 

  • Slice your butter into chunks and combine it with 8 cups of mini marshmallows in a large mixing bowl. Microwave for 2 minutes.
  • Immediately stir until the marshmallows are no longer chunky and the butter is fully mixed in.
  • Add the remaining 2 cups marshmallows and 5 cups Lucky Charms to the melted marshmallows and gently fold together until the cereal and unmelted marshmallows are fully covered.
  • Spray a 9×13 cake pan with nonstick cooking spray. Add the mixture to the pan and gently spread even in the pan.
  • Sprinkle the remaining cup of Lucky Charms over the top and lightly press to ensure it sticks to the top.
  • Let rest for about an hour or until set.
  • Slice into squares and enjoy!
